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Galapagos Oryzomys | Twin-spotted Tree Frog |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um same | Chordata (Chordates) | Chordata (Chordates) |
| Class | Mammalia (Mammals) | Amphibia (Amphibians) |
| Order | Rodentia (Rodents) | Anura (Frogs & Toads) |
| Family | Cricetidae | Rhacophoridae |
| Genus | Aegialomys | Rhacophorus |
| Species | Aegialomys galapagoensis | Rhacophorus bipunctatus |
